The 2010 Blogging While Brown Conference in Washington DC has come and gone, and once again, it was an event filled with knowledge, camaraderie, and spirit. Founded by Black Weblog Award winner Gina McCauley in 2008, the purpose of the conference is to facilitate conversations that lead to collaboration and innovation among bloggers of color — African-American bloggers in particular. Emphasis is placed on stimulating interaction between the attendees, and all conference activities and events are aimed at fostering a shared experience which forms the basis of new relationships or strengthens relationships already in existence.

Now that we are confirmed on the SXSW Interactive Festival schedule for 2010, we can give some more information on our panel, including the panelists and location.

As stated before, we will be in the Austin Convention Center, where a majority of the SXSW Interactive Festival panels and conversations take place. We will be in room 9ABCD. Currently, we’re working on being able to do a live broadcast of the panel as well, so if you will be in the Austin area and will be at SXSW, please let us know!

There are four panelists (three speakers and a moderator): Gina McCauley of Blogging While Brown, Deanna Sutton of Clutch Magazine Online, J. Smith of jbrotherlove, and Maurice Cherry of 3eighteen media and the Black Weblog Awards. Panelist bios are located after the jump.
